Output 5100284a08f47bb2afe71747dd6f625b733c441ea4594b709a4fdececb813fa3:117

value
2911810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8931b639a5e68ee1a1219534bd22e78e76e0c77b OP_EQUAL
address
3ECS3rxTU4NV6E2XhVb6PtJwrgoqEFQqri
transaction
5100284a08f47bb2afe71747dd6f625b733c441ea4594b709a4fdececb813fa3
spent
true